For me (Windows Mobile developer) the WM plugin is indespensible. I simply couldn't manage without it now. That's not to say that it's perfect, however...

Here are a few for the wish list:
  • I love the RAPI shell execute functionality, where you can launch a .exe on the remote device simply by double-clicking in SS. A great enhancement would be to make it also launch associated files - e.g. CAB files get launched with wceload, etc.

    A remote registry editor

    A remote task viewer - would save me having to load eVC!

    The remote file viewer doesn't always detect changes to files. If you open a file with F3, change the file on the device and hit F3 again, you get the old version loaded from cache

    Unzip files directly to the WM plugin - useful, but not vital
Hope this is useful feedback. Keep it coming!
